Campbell, Gauteng, South Afric...
Campbell, Gauteng, South Afric...
Campbellsville, Kentucky, Unit...
South Campbell, LONDON, United...
Campbell, Gauteng, South Afric...
Campbell, Gauteng, South Afric...
DUTYWA, Gauteng, South Africa.
Westville, Gauteng, South Afri...
Ahrens, Gauteng, South Africa.
Shoprite Central, South Africa...
India, India, India.
johannesburg, gauteng, south A...